1
resposta

Minha Resposta:

def saudacao(hora):
    if hora < 12:
        return "Bom dia!"
    elif 12 <= hora < 18:
        return "Boa tarde!"
    else:
        return "Boa noite!"

hora = int(input("Digite a hora atual (0-23): "))
print(saudacao(hora))
1 resposta

Olá, Luiz, como vai?

O seu código foi desenvolvido de forma muito clara e organizada, utilizando corretamente as estruturas condicionais if, elif e else para categorizar os períodos do dia. A lógica aplicada para os intervalos de horas atende perfeitamente aos requisitos do desafio, garantindo que a saudação correta seja exibida conforme a entrada do usuário.

Parabéns pela excelente resolução e por compartilhar seu progresso no fórum.

Continue postando seus exercícios para inspirar outros estudantes.

Alura Conte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!